Improve windows resource compiler executable selection
Always honour any windres setting in cross-file (we can't be compiling with msvc, but this should apply when cross-compiling using gcc or clang) Always honour WINDRES environment variable Otherwise look for the resource compiler which is part of the same toolset as the C or C++ compiler. Add some commentary on why the conventions for compiled resource file extensions differ between RC and windres Also don't try to report non-existent path when we couldn't find the resource compiler.

+The resource compiler executable used is the first which exists from the
+following list:
+
+1. The `windres` executable given in the `[binaries]` section of the cross-file
+2. The `WINDRES` environment variable
+3. The resource compiler which is part of the same toolset as the C or C++ compiler in use.
